Anglar Dependence of Self-Diffraction Efficiency of Laser Induced Thermal Gratings

    The anglar dependence of self-diffraction efficiency of laser-induced thermal gratings is discussed. Experimental results show that the efficiency is inversely proportiona1 to the fourth power of the angle. The theoretical analysis explains the experimental results.
